The Myth of the 30-Minute Anabolic Window
For decades, a cornerstone of fitness lore was the concept of the 'anabolic window'. This was believed to be a brief 30-to-60-minute period immediately following exercise when your muscles were uniquely primed to absorb nutrients. Missing this window, the theory went, meant subpar muscle repair and growth. This rigid belief led to the common sight of gym-goers frantically shaking and chugging their protein supplements moments after their final rep. However, sports nutrition science has evolved significantly, revealing a much more flexible reality. The 'anabolic window' is now understood to be far longer, with your muscles remaining sensitized to protein intake for several hours, and even up to 24 hours post-workout.
Why Immediate Timing Isn't Crucial for Most People
Modern research emphasizes that for the average person, overall daily protein intake is far more important than the specific timing of a single shake. As long as you consume adequate protein throughout the day, whether you have your shake immediately or a few hours later is unlikely to make a significant difference to your results.
There are several reasons for this:
- Extended Muscle Sensitization: The period where your muscles are more receptive to protein, known as muscle protein synthesis, is elevated for a substantial amount of time after your training session, not just a fleeting 30 minutes.
- Pre-Workout Fueling: If you have eaten a protein-containing meal a few hours before your workout, your blood is already circulating with amino acids. This effectively extends the anabolic window, as your body is not starting from a depleted state.
- Slow Digestion: After a moderate to high-intensity workout, your body diverts blood flow away from the digestive system to the muscles being worked. Consuming a large amount of liquid protein immediately can overload your system and potentially lead to gastrointestinal discomfort, bloating, or nausea.
Potential Downsides of Rushing Your Shake
While there are no major health risks for healthy individuals, rushing your protein shake can have some drawbacks. The primary concern for some is stomach upset. Immediately after an intense workout, your digestive system is not at its most efficient. Pushing a heavy shake into a system that is still stressed can result in discomfort. Furthermore, a shake should always be considered a supplement to a whole-foods diet, not a replacement. Relying too heavily on shakes can cause you to miss out on other essential nutrients, fiber, and micronutrients found in solid foods.

Different Protein Types and Their Timing
For strategic timing, the type of protein matters due to varying absorption rates.
- Whey Protein: This is a fast-digesting protein, making it a good choice for post-workout if you prefer to consume it relatively soon. It provides a rapid influx of amino acids.
- Casein Protein: This is a slow-digesting protein that forms a gel in the stomach, releasing amino acids gradually. This makes it an ideal option for before bed, providing a steady supply of protein to muscles during overnight fasting.
- Plant-Based Protein: Options like pea, rice, or hemp protein powders vary in their digestion speed and amino acid profiles. Some blends combine different plant sources to create a complete protein profile.
Comparison of Post-Workout Fueling Strategies
| Feature | Shake Immediately Post-Workout | Real Food Meal Later | Combination (Shake & Meal) |
|---|---|---|---|
| Timing Urgency | High (based on outdated 'anabolic window' theory) | Low (several hours after workout is fine) | Low to Medium (based on convenience) |
| Convenience | Very High (pre-mixed or powder) | Lower (requires preparation) | High (quick shake followed by planned meal) |
| Digestive Impact | Potential for GI upset after high intensity | Less likely to cause GI distress | Depends on exercise intensity and composition |
| Nutritional Profile | Often limited to protein (some carbs/fats added) | Comprehensive nutrients (fiber, vitamins, minerals) | Excellent (combo of quick protein and balanced meal) |
| Primary Benefit | Satisfies psychological need to refuel immediately | Best for overall nutrient intake and satiety | Optimal for strategic refueling and convenience |
Conclusion: Focus on Consistency Over Chronology
The traditional rush to consume a protein shake immediately after a workout is an outdated practice based on a misconception of the 'anabolic window'. While consuming protein after exercise is certainly beneficial for muscle repair and recovery, modern science confirms that the timing is much more flexible than previously thought. For most fitness enthusiasts, prioritizing total daily protein intake and distributing it evenly throughout the day is the most effective strategy for muscle growth and maintenance. Whether you prefer a shake directly after your session, or a whole-food meal a few hours later, the most important factor is consistency. Don't let the fear of missing a narrow time frame dictate your routine. Instead, find a refueling schedule that fits your lifestyle, goals, and digestive comfort.
